Barodontalgia, commonly known as tooth squeeze, is a pain in a tooth caused by a change in ambient pressure. The pain usually ceases at return to the original pressure.[1][2][3] Dental barotrauma is a condition in which such changes in ambient pressure cause damage to the dentition.
